Niccolo' is a variant of the Greek name Nikolaos, which means 'victory of the people' (from 'nike' meaning victory and 'laos' meaning people). It has strong historical roots, especially in Italy, and was popularized during the Renaissance period. The name signifies leadership and triumph.

Cultural Significance of Niccolo'

Niccolo' has deep cultural roots in Italy, especially during the Renaissance, where it was borne by influential figures like Niccolò Machiavelli. The name carries connotations of intellect, strategy, and leadership. It reflects a blend of classical heritage and Renaissance humanism, symbolizing victory and popular strength across European history.

Niccolò Machiavelli

Italian Renaissance political philosopher and author of 'The Prince,' known for his ideas on political power and statecraft.

Niccolò Paganini

Renowned Italian violinist and composer, famous for his virtuoso technique and influence on classical music.

Niccolò Jommelli

Italian composer notable for his operas and sacred music during the 18th century.

Fun Fact About Niccolo'

Niccolo' Machiavelli, the most famous bearer, wrote 'The Prince,' a seminal political treatise that introduced concepts still discussed in political theory today.
